The key thing to get right with chickpea burgers, is flavour. Don't get me wrong, I love chickpeas. I'd happily drown myself in a vat of houmous any day, but where they really work is when they are complemented by the right flavours. For these Vegan Chickpea Burgers, I use a combination of garlic, lemon, smoked paprika, cumin and chilli powder; Just enough chilli powder to make you notice but not so much as to make them truly spicy. You could add a lot more spice if you want to go down that road.

You won't find that chickpea burgers hold together quite as well as meat ones. They just aren't as firm and will need more delicate handling. To help hold them together, make sure you drain the chickpeas and the sweetcorn really well and don't skip the step of putting them in the fridge to set!
